What Is One Rep Max (1RM)?

The one rep max meaning is straightforward: it’s the maximum amount of weight you can lift for one complete repetition of an exercise while maintaining proper form. It represents your peak strength capability for that specific movement.

Actual 1RM vs. Estimated 1RM

There’s an important distinction between your actual 1RM (tested by lifting to true failure) and your estimated 1RM (calculated using a formula based on submaximal lifts).

  • Actual 1RM: Requires attempting a maximal lift, which carries significant injury risk, especially when performed without proper preparation or technique.
  • Estimated 1RM: Calculated using validated formulas based on how many reps you can perform with a lighter weight. This is much safer and almost as accurate for training purposes.

For beginners, we strongly recommend avoiding actual 1RM testing entirely. Your technique, connective tissues, and nervous system need time to adapt to strength training. Using a 1RM calculator provides all the benefits of knowing your max strength without the risks.

How a One Rep Max Calculator Works

Understanding how to calculate one rep max requires knowing the basic principle: as the number of repetitions increases, the weight you can lift decreases in a predictable pattern. This relationship allows us to estimate your one-rep maximum from submaximal efforts.

Popular 1RM Formulas

Our calculator uses the most scientifically validated one rep max formulas:

  • Epley Formula: 1RM = Weight × (1 + Reps/30)
  • Brzycki Formula: 1RM = Weight × (36 / (37 – Reps))
  • Lombardi Formula: 1RM = Weight × Reps^0.1

Why do we average multiple formulas? Different formulas have varying accuracy at different rep ranges. By averaging the results from several validated equations, we get a more reliable estimate that works well across all rep ranges from 2-10 reps.

One Rep Max Formula (Simple Explanation)

Epley Formula

The Epley formula is one of the most commonly used equations for estimating 1RM: 1RM = Weight × (1 + Reps/30)

Example calculation: If you lifted 185 lbs for 5 reps: 1RM = 185 × (1 + 5/30) = 185 × 1.1667 = 215.8 lbs

Brzycki Formula

The Brzycki formula tends to be more accurate for lower rep ranges (2-5 reps): 1RM = Weight × (36 / (37 – Reps))

Using the same example: 1RM = 185 × (36 / (37 – 5)) = 185 × (36/32) = 185 × 1.125 = 208.1 lbs

Which Formula Is Best?

Different formulas excel at different rep ranges:

  • 2-5 reps: Brzycki formula tends to be most accurate
  • 5-10 reps: Epley and Lombardi formulas work well
  • Beginners: All formulas provide useful estimates, but consistency matters most
  • Advanced lifters: Consider using the formula that best matches your typical training rep range

That’s why our calculator averages multiple formulas—it provides the most reliable estimate across all situations.

One Rep Max Chart (Weight × Reps Table)

This one rep max chart shows the percentage of your 1RM that you can typically lift for different rep ranges. Use this table to plan your training weights based on your estimated 1RM.

Reps % of 1RM Example: If 1RM = 200 lbs Training Purpose
1 100% 200 lbs Maximal strength testing
2 95% 190 lbs Strength development
3 93% 186 lbs Strength development
4 90% 180 lbs Strength development
5 87% 174 lbs Strength/hypertrophy
6 85% 170 lbs Strength/hypertrophy
7 83% 166 lbs Hypertrophy
8 80% 160 lbs Hypertrophy
9 77% 154 lbs Hypertrophy/endurance
10 75% 150 lbs Hypertrophy/endurance

How to use this chart: Once you’ve calculated your 1RM using our calculator, multiply it by the percentage in the table to determine appropriate weights for different rep ranges in your training.

How to Use Your 1RM for Training

Knowing your estimated 1RM allows you to design precise, effective training programs. Here’s how to apply your 1RM to different training goals:

Strength Training Percentages

  • 85–95% of 1RM (1-5 reps): Maximal strength development. Focus on neural adaptations and improving lifting technique.
  • 70–80% of 1RM (6-12 reps): Hypertrophy (muscle growth). Optimal range for stimulating muscle protein synthesis.
  • 60–70% of 1RM (12-15+ reps): Muscular endurance. Improves fatigue resistance and metabolic conditioning.

Weekly Programming Example

For a lifter with a bench press 1RM of 225 lbs:

  • Monday (Strength): 3 sets of 5 reps at 85% (191 lbs)
  • Wednesday (Hypertrophy): 3 sets of 10 reps at 75% (169 lbs)
  • Friday (Power): 5 sets of 3 reps at 90% (203 lbs)

This approach allows you to train different qualities while using weights that are challenging but safe.

One Rep Max by Exercise

While our 1RM calculator works for any exercise, accuracy varies between movements. Here’s what to know about estimating 1RM for different lifts:

Bench Press 1RM

1RM formulas tend to be most accurate for bench press due to the movement’s consistent mechanics. Most lifters can estimate bench press 1RM within 3-5% accuracy using calculators.

Squat 1RM

Squat estimates are generally reliable but may slightly underestimate true max due to the higher technical demands and fatigue factors involved in squatting.

Deadlift 1RM

Deadlift 1RM estimates can vary more than other lifts due to the significant grip and form factors involved. Many lifters can actually deadlift more than formulas predict.

Overhead Press 1RM

Shoulder press estimates are usually accurate, but be conservative with progression as the shoulder joint is particularly vulnerable to overuse injuries.

Important: Always use your estimated 1RM as a starting point, not an absolute value. Adjust based on how the weights feel during your actual training sessions.

Safety Tips When Estimating One Rep Max

Even when using a calculator instead of testing, follow these safety guidelines:

  • Always warm up properly: 5-10 minutes of light cardio followed by dynamic stretching and light sets of your planned exercise.
  • Avoid failure reps: When collecting data for the calculator, stop 1-2 reps short of failure to ensure safety and form maintenance.
  • Don’t test maxes frequently: Even estimated maxes should be calculated no more than once every 4-8 weeks to allow for actual strength development.
  • Beginners disclaimer: If you’re new to strength training (less than 6 months), focus on learning proper form rather than chasing numbers. Use very conservative estimates.
  • Listen to your body: If you’re experiencing pain (not to be confused with normal muscle fatigue), reduce weights and consult a professional.

Frequently Asked Questions (FAQ)

How accurate is a one rep max calculator?

Scientific studies show that estimated 1RM calculations are typically within 2-5% of actual tested 1RM values when using the appropriate formula for the rep range. Our calculator averages multiple formulas to achieve accuracy of 95-98% for most lifters.

Can beginners use a 1RM calculator?

Yes! In fact, beginners should use a calculator instead of testing their actual 1RM. It allows you to establish training weights safely while avoiding the injury risks associated with maximal lifting attempts.

Is it safe to calculate 1RM every week?

While calculating is safer than testing, we recommend recalculating your 1RM no more than once every 4-8 weeks. Strength gains occur gradually, and frequent recalculations can lead to premature weight increases that compromise form.

What reps give the most accurate 1RM calculation?

For optimal accuracy, use a weight that allows you to complete 3-8 reps with good form. The 5-rep range tends to provide the best balance of accuracy and safety across all formulas.

Should I use pounds or kilograms in the calculator?

Either unit works perfectly! The formulas are unit-agnostic. Just be consistent—use the same units for input that you use in your training. Our calculator handles both pounds and kilograms.
